Job Title: Data Center - Sales Application Engineer
Company: Infinitum
Location: Austin or Remote (Must be located near a major metropolitan area)
Travel: Up to 30%
Reports To: Sr. Director of Business Development
About the role:
We are seeking a technically skilled and detail-oriented Sales Application Engineer to join our growing Data Center team. This role is critical in supporting the sales and implementation of retrofit fan kit solutions directly to data center operators and facility teams. The role will serve as the technical liaison between internal teams, fan partners, mechanical contractors, and end users to ensure every retrofit solution is seamlessly integrated into existing infrastructure.
This role will deliver technically sound, commercially viable retrofit fan solutions to data center customers by collaborating with internal teams, fan partners, and design stakeholders—ensuring mechanical fit, optimized performance, and successful project execution from initial inquiry to final implementation resulting in 4 converted opportunities to revenue by end of Y2025 and 10 to revenue by end of Y2026.

A "disabled veteran" is one of the following: a veteran of the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service who is entitled to compensation (or who but for the receipt of military retired pay would be entitled to compensation) under laws administered by the Secretary of Veterans Affairs; or a person who was discharged or released from active duty because of a service-connected disability.
A "recently separated veteran" means any veteran during the three-year period beginning on the date of such veteran's discharge or release from active duty in the U.S. military, ground, naval, or air service.
An "active duty wartime or campaign badge veteran" means a veteran who served on active duty in the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service during a war, or in a campaign or expedition for which a campaign badge has been authorized under the laws administered by the Department of Defense.
An "Armed forces service medal veteran" means a veteran who, while serving on active duty in the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service, participated in a United States military operation for which an Armed Forces service medal was awarded pursuant to Executive Order 12985.
